Dryer Loud But No Error Code: What It Means

Quick Answer

If your dryer is loud but shows no error code, the problem is usually mechanical, not electronic. Most dryers do not monitor rollers, idler pulleys, blower wheels, or drum seals, so they can fail loudly without triggering a code. First action: stop the cycle and identify when the noise happens (startup, rotating, heating, cooling). That timing points directly to the failing part.

Identify the Noise First

Match the noise to when it occurs. This is the fastest way to separate a harmless sound from a mechanical part starting to seize or loosen.

  • During drum rotation: rumble, thump, scraping, rhythmic squeak that repeats once per drum turn usually points to drum support parts or something catching the drum.
  • At startup: sharp squeal or brief grind right as the motor starts often points to a dry idler pulley, a stiff drum roller, or a blower wheel rubbing as the motor accelerates.
  • During heating: pinging/ticking that gets louder as the dryer warms can be heat expansion noise, but a hot-only squeal commonly indicates a marginal bearing or pulley that worsens when warm.
  • During cooling cycle: noise that appears after heat shuts off but the drum keeps turning still tracks to rotating parts (rollers/idler/blower). If the noise changes when heat stops, check for heat-warped felt seals or a blower wheel that shifts as temperatures change.
  • Constant (continuous): a steady roar or air-hiss that does not rise and fall with drum speed is often airflow restriction or a blower housing contact. A steady metallic scrape is usually drum-to-front/rear contact.
  • Intermittent: rattles and clicking that come and go often indicate a loose object (coin, screw, bra wire) or a cracked blower wheel slipping on the motor shaft.

What This Noise Usually Means

No error code usually means the control board thinks the dryer is running normally: the motor turns, the door switch is closed, and basic temperature/thermistor inputs look acceptable. Mechanical wear parts can be failing while the dryer still meets the minimum conditions to run.

Common examples:

  • Drum support rollers develop flat spots or dry bearings. The dryer runs, but the drum becomes loud under load.
  • The idler pulley bearing dries out or seizes intermittently. Belt tension remains, so no code appears.
  • A blower wheel loosens or cracks. Air still moves enough to avoid a fault, but the wheel wobbles and hits the housing.
  • Front/rear drum glides or felt seals wear through. The drum rubs metal, but electronics do not monitor it.

Most Common Causes

  • Worn drum support rollers: low rumble, thump-thump, or growl that follows drum speed, often worse with heavy loads.
  • Failing idler pulley: squeal or chirp, sometimes loudest at startup; may quiet briefly after warming up.
  • Blower wheel rubbing or cracked: roaring, buzzing, or periodic scraping; can be constant regardless of load size.
  • Objects in the blower housing or drum seals: clicking, ticking, or scraping; often intermittent and may change when load shifts.
  • Worn drum glides/felt seals: scraping, metal-on-metal sound, or a rough dragging noise near the front of the drum.
  • Loose motor mount or worn motor bearing: deeper hum, vibration, or squeal that can persist even with an empty drum; less common but important.
  • Belt issues: slapping sound (belt seam or mis-tracking) or chirp; typically changes with drum speed and load.

How to Check Safely

These checks are designed to confirm a mechanical issue without guessing and without needing meters or electronic diagnostics.

  • Step 1: Stop and reset the conditions
    • Run the dryer empty for 2 minutes. If the noise is the same, suspect rollers, idler, blower wheel, glides, or motor rather than a heavy load causing normal tumbling thumps.
    • Run a small load. If the noise appears only when loaded, drum rollers and glides move higher on the list.
  • Step 2: Note exact timing
    • If the noise starts the moment the Start button is pressed and before the drum reaches speed, suspect idler pulley or motor/blower area.
    • If it begins only after the drum is fully rotating, suspect drum support parts or something catching the drum.
  • Step 3: Listen at three locations
    • Near the front lower panel: idler pulley and front glides tend to be loudest here.
    • Near the rear panel: rear rollers and rear seal issues project here.
    • Near the lint filter/duct area: blower wheel noises often radiate here.
  • Step 4: Quick airflow check (blower and restriction clue)
    • Verify strong airflow at the outside vent hood while running. Weak airflow plus a roaring/blower-type noise suggests restriction or a blower wheel issue.
    • Clean the lint screen and inspect the lint screen housing for lint buildup that can drop into the blower.
  • Step 5: Check for loose items without disassembly
    • Open the door and inspect the drum seam and front lip for screws, coins, or sharp items.
    • Spin the drum by hand (dryer off). A smooth, quiet rotation is normal. A rough spot, scrape, or repeating squeak indicates a roller flat spot, glide wear, or a foreign object.
  • Step 6: If you are comfortable removing one panel
    • Unplug the dryer. Remove the lower front access panel or rear panel (varies by model) to visually inspect for obvious issues: shredded belt rubber, lint clumps near the blower, or a wobbling blower wheel.
    • Do not run the dryer with guards removed unless the design specifically allows a safe service position and you can keep hands/tools clear of moving parts.

When This Is Normal vs A Problem

Usually normal

  • Light ticking for the first minute of heat as metal expands, then it settles down.
  • Soft thumps during the first few minutes with bulky items as the load redistributes.
  • Air rushing sound that stays consistent and the dryer dries normally.

Usually a problem

  • Rumbling or thumping that steadily worsens over days or weeks.
  • Squealing that lasts more than a few seconds at startup or returns repeatedly during the cycle.
  • Scraping or metal-on-metal sounds at any time.
  • Roaring plus weak drying performance or a hot cabinet, which suggests airflow trouble or blower contact.
  • Noise that is loudest with an empty drum, which points away from normal load movement and toward worn parts.

When to Call a Technician

  • Call now if you hear metal scraping, grinding that changes the drum speed, or the dryer vibrates hard enough to walk. Continued use can damage the drum, front bulkhead, or blower housing.
  • Call if you suspect the blower wheel or motor: accessing and confirming these parts varies by model, and mistakes can crack the wheel, damage wiring, or create airflow issues.
  • DIY is reasonable if you can safely access the belt path and drum support kit on your model and the noise clearly matches rollers/idler/glides. Many repairs are straightforward but require partial disassembly and correct reassembly.
  • Call if the dryer is stacked, gas, or hardwired and you cannot easily move it or disconnect it safely.

How to Prevent This Problem

  • Do not overload: heavy loads accelerate roller flat-spotting and glide wear.
  • Keep airflow strong: clean the lint screen every load and keep the vent system clear to reduce heat stress on seals and blower components.
  • Empty pockets: small metal items commonly end up in the blower housing and create intermittent rattles and scraping.
  • Address new noises early: replacing an idler pulley or roller set early is cheaper than replacing a grooved drum rim or damaged bulkhead.
  • Use mixed-load practices: avoid running single heavy items (one bath mat, one shoe) that can repeatedly hammer the same drum position.

Related Dryer Noise Problems

  • Dryer squeals only for the first 10 seconds: often idler pulley or roller bearing drying out.
  • Dryer makes a roaring noise and dries slowly: blower wheel damage or severe vent restriction.
  • Dryer makes scraping noise near the door: front glides or felt seal worn through.
  • Dryer thumps once per drum revolution: roller flat spot or a dented drum catching a seal.
  • Dryer rattles intermittently like a coin: foreign object in drum baffle, seal gap, or blower housing.

Frequently Asked Questions

Why is my dryer so loud but it still works normally?

Because most loud dryer problems are mechanical and the dryer can still tumble and heat. Rollers, idler pulleys, glides, and blower wheels can be noisy for weeks before they fail completely, and the control board typically has no sensor for those parts.

Can a dryer have a bad roller or idler pulley without any code?

Yes. The dryer only needs the motor to run and basic safety circuits to be satisfied. A worn roller or idler can squeal or thump while still keeping the drum moving, so the electronics see normal operation.

My dryer is loud only when it is heating. What does that suggest?

If the noise truly appears only with heat, suspect a felt seal starting to drag as it warms, or a marginal bearing that gets louder when lubricants thin out with temperature. Also check airflow: overheating from a restricted vent can worsen rubbing sounds and make the dryer noisier overall.

Is it safe to keep using a loud dryer if it has no error code?

It depends on the noise. Light, brief ticking at heat startup can be normal. Squealing, rumbling, or any scraping should be treated as a repair-needed condition. Continued use can wear through glides, groove the drum, or damage the blower housing.

What is the most common part that makes a loud thumping noise?

Drum support rollers are the most common cause. A flat spot or worn bearing creates a repeatable thump once per drum revolution, often worse with heavier loads and often loudest near the rear of the cabinet.
